Revit 2013, no Templates or Libraries installed

I've installed Revit 2013 both from download and again today from thumb drive.


When starting Revit I get an error that the path for the default family templates is invalid.
Checking file locations it looking at C:\ProgramData\Autodesk\RVT 2013\Family Templates\Chinese.
I don't know why its looking for Chinese but anyway Family Templates is missing.

The folder \RVT 2013\ only has 2 folders in it, Recent & UserDataCache.

 

The corresponding folder in Revit 2012, has Family Templates, IES, Libraries & Templates, none of which are in my \RVT 2013\ folder.
I put in a support request to autodesk subscription last week but haven't had a reply.

Has anyone else seen this problem or know a solution.

 

Dell XPS17, Windows 7 64 bit.

Found the problem.

Needed to add *.autodesk.com to Internet Options/Security Tab/Trusted Sites

Try this

1. Close all Autodesk software
2. Go to Control Panel > Programs and features
3. Select <Revit product and version> from the list and click Uninstall/Change
4. From the resulting screen the very left button on the bottom will be "Add or Remove Features" Click this
5. The resulting screen will list the content packs that can be installed, please make sure both Australia and US Metric are selected and click Next.
(It is worth noting at this point that during the install process, Revit default to US as the region when accepting the Licence Agreement and this in turn effects the default content that will be installed.)
6. Start up <Revit product and version> and you should now have the families and templates installed.

If this does not work repeat the above steps again twice, the first time, untick all content and the second time ticking all the desired content back on again.
